On Tuesday, a gun battle occurred outside the Israeli consulate in Istanbul, Turkey, resulting in the deaths of two attackers and injuries to two police officers. The confrontation lasted nearly 10 minutes and took place in a high-security area, which has seen increased police presence due to the ongoing Hamas-Israel conflict that began in 2023. Video footage revealed one assailant firing an automatic rifle and handgun while moving between parked police vehicles. The attack raised concerns as there are currently no Israeli diplomats stationed in Turkey, highlighting the heightened security measures in place.
